Hungarian Tennis player Tímea Babos alongside Kristina Mladenovic qualified to the quarter-finals at Wimbledon Ladies’ Double. The Hungaro-French duo played an impressive game and have won the first set within 24 minutes. The next set saw setbacks as Babos and Mladenovic faced sterner opposition, but with a great comeback managed to secure qualification within a swift 61 minutes.
The quarter-finals, however, may prove to be more of a difficult match-up as Babos and Mladenovic could either face first-seeded Taiwanese-Chinese duo of Hsieh Su-wei and Peng Shuai or the Ukrainian-Polish pair of Julija Bejgelzimer and Klaudia Jans-Ignacik. The Hungarian tennis player will also feature in a mixed double match alongside Eric Butorac (USA), with fourth-seeded Leander Peas and Cara Black as opponents.
Round of 16 results: Tímea Babos, Kristina Mladenovic – Belinda Bencic, Cvetana Pironkova, 6:1, 6:3
